I really am struggling to find fun things to do on my 80 twink nowadays (probably because most stuff has been soloed). As much as I enjoyed the cross-realm 25man raids, they're too much of a hassle to organise and killing bosses in ~20 seconds would become boring rather fast.
Would anyone be interested in doing something (aka raids) on a regular basis (every 1-2 weeks) on horde side? Here's a few ideas:
- Gear Appropriate Raids: Do raids in the gear you would have used back in WotLK (or maybe a tier lower to compensate for class/talent changes)
- "How Far Can We Get": Set a bunch of rules (like only ilvl 200 gear that you can get without raiding, or only WotLK blue items) and see how far we can progress through 10man raids starting from the beginning
- 10man team raiding 25man content: Exactly what it says on the tin. Using any gear, see how much of the 25man content we can clear as a raid of 10 people (probably all of it tbh)
- Homemade Hardmodes / Custom Achievements: Think of any crazy challenges to make killing the bosses more interesting (and then do it!)
- Single class/role raids: Like the 80 Mage raid I did a while back. Harder to find people though (and unfair on classes that aren't included).
- Sha of Anger: If we could find enough 80s (which is doubtful) then it would be amazing to give this a proper try. Would have to be only melee dps though due to hit/miss mechanics.
Most of these would only work if we could pull together 8-10 reliable, skilled and motivated twinks. I'd even be tempted to restart Legacy if we managed to find enough decent people who felt they wanted to be part of a guild instead of just raiding via cross-realm.
Anyways, post if anything on that list takes your interest or if you have some ideas of your own to share.
